Commercial truck drivers face arduous hours of work: driving back and forth across the country, often with strict deadlines to meet and profit-driven employers to be held accountable to, they rarely have time to rest. As a result, it is common to see sleep-deprived truck drivers fall asleep at the wheel, veer off the road, speed, or engage in other forms of reckless driving. The Federal Motor Carrier Safety Administration (FMCSA) reports that each year, there are over 20,000 injuries and 750 deaths on the road because of truck driver fatigue. According to FMCSA, the risk of a traffic accident doubles from the eighth to tenth consecutive hour of driving alone. This statistic doubles yet again from the tenth to eleventh hour of driving. .

In order to address these concerns and reduce truck injuries and fatalities, FMCSA instituted the Hours-of-Service regulations, which limit the amount of time and the manner in which commercial truck drivers may drive on the road. Among those regulations: truck drivers may only drive a maximum of 11 hours after 10 consecutive hours off duty (or a maximum of 10 hours after 8 consecutive hours off duty if there are passengers in the truck). Violations will result in heavy civil penalties. New changes in the December 2011 revision of the rules include a mandatory 30-minute rest break at least every 8 hours or less on the road and limitations on minimum "34-hour restarts."

In addition, truck drivers must document their compliance with trucking regulations by keeping logs or records of expenses.
